What Makes a Dog Gentle and Kid-Friendly?

Gentle Dog Breeds

Temperament: Calm, Affectionate, and Patient

A family-friendly dog must be patient and composed, even in unpredictable situations. Children can be loud, playful, and sometimes unintentionally rough, so a good family dog should tolerate excitement without reacting negatively.

Energy Levels: The Balance Between Playful and Relaxed

Some kids love to run and play, while others prefer to cuddle. The ideal family dog matches your child’s activity level—whether it’s an energetic Beagle or a calm Basset Hound.

Size Considerations: Big vs. Small Breeds for Kids

Larger breeds like Newfoundlands are known for their gentle nature, while smaller dogs like Cavalier King Charles Spaniels are affectionate lap dogs. Choosing the right size depends on space, family lifestyle, and child age.

Trainability: Easily Trainable Breeds Are Ideal for Families

A well-trained dog is a happy dog. Breeds that are naturally eager to please—such as Labradors and Golden Retrievers—make training easier, ensuring a harmonious home environment.

Social Nature: Dogs That Naturally Bond with Children

Some dogs thrive on companionship and form deep bonds with their families. Dogs like Collies and Poodles are known for their loyalty and affection, making them ideal lifelong friends for kids.

Top Gentle Dog Breeds That Are Great for Kids

Labrador Retriever – The Classic Family Dog

Labs are playful, intelligent, and endlessly affectionate. They adapt well to family life, are easy to train, and have a naturally friendly disposition, making them one of the best choices for households with children.

Golden Retriever – The Gentle Companion

Golden Retrievers are known for their patience and kindness. They thrive on human interaction and love playing with kids, making them a heartwarming addition to any family.

Cavalier King Charles Spaniel – Small Yet Loving

These little dogs adore human companionship. They fit well in small homes or apartments and love snuggling, making them a great match for younger children.

Beagle – Energetic and Friendly

Beagles are small, sturdy, and packed with energy. They enjoy playing and exploring, but their affectionate nature ensures they stay close to their families.

Newfoundland – The Gentle Giant

Known as “nanny dogs,” Newfoundlands are incredibly patient and protective of children. Their calm demeanor makes them one of the safest choices for families.

Poodle – Intelligent and Affectionate

Poodles are highly intelligent and adaptable, making them easy to train. Their hypoallergenic coat is an added bonus for families with allergy concerns.

Bernese Mountain Dog – Big, Sweet, and Loyal

Bernese Mountain Dogs are affectionate, protective, and gentle giants. They require space to roam but are deeply loyal to their human families.

Collie – The Intelligent Protector

Collies, made famous by Lassie, are excellent family dogs. They are highly trainable, protective, and naturally gentle with children.

Basset Hound – Laid-Back and Loving

Their droopy eyes and floppy ears make them look perpetually sad, but Basset Hounds are some of the most affectionate dogs around. They’re mellow, making them perfect for families that want a low-energy companion.

Irish Setter – Playful and Gentle Spirit

With their striking red coat and fun-loving nature, Irish Setters bring joy to any household. They love kids and thrive on interactive play.

How to Introduce a Dog to Your Kids

  • Teach kids how to approach dogs gently and respectfully.
  • Allow the dog to explore at its own pace.
  • Supervise initial interactions to build a strong bond.

Training Tips for Gentle Dog Breeds

Early training and socialization are key. Using positive reinforcement ensures a well-behaved, confident dog that interacts safely with children.

Caring for a Gentle Dog in a Family Home

Proper nutrition, grooming, and regular vet visits keep your furry friend healthy and happy.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Choosing a Family Dog

  • Selecting a breed without considering lifestyle compatibility.
  • Ignoring training and socialization.
  • Failing to set boundaries for both kids and dogs.
